Resamirigene bilparvovec is an investigational gene therapy designed to treat X-linked myotubular myopathy (XLMTM), a severe and often fatal genetic disorder primarily affecting male infants. The disease is caused by mutations in the MTM1 gene, which encodes the protein myotubularin. Resamirigene bilparvovec consists of a functional copy of the human MTM1 gene delivered via an adeno-associated virus serotype 8 (AAV8) vector, administered as a single intravenous infusion. The therapy aims to restore myotubularin expression in skeletal muscle, potentially improving motor function and reducing ventilator dependence in affected children. Development has been led by Astellas Gene Therapies (formerly Audentes Therapeutics), with preclinical work conducted in collaboration with Genethon. As of late 2023, clinical development remains on hold following safety concerns related to liver failure observed during trials[1][4][5][6][8].
